    "Київська справа": Корупція в українській міліції 1920-х років.Oksana Mikheyeva - 2011 - Схід (2(109)):101-106.
    The article deals with the study of specific aspects of daily life of management and ordinary workers of the Ukrainian police at the mid 1920's based on the much-discussed in the press "Kievcase". This case was about systematic bribery in Ukrainian police (in modern language - about corruption). In this way we have detected the conditions, causes and mechanisms of the corruption that matter for the modern study of this phenomenon.

    Affective and Semantic Representations of Valence: A Conceptual Framework.Oksana Itkes & Assaf Kron - 2019 - Emotion Review 11 (4):283-293.
    The current article discusses the distinction between affective valence—the degree to which an affective response represents pleasure or displeasure—and semantic valence, the degree to which an object or event is considered positive or negative. To date, measures that reflect positivity and negativity are usually placed under the same conceptual umbrella (e.g., valence, affective, emotional), with minimal distinction between the modes of valence they reflect.     Structure of human serum cholinesterase.Oksana Lockridge - 1988 - Bioessays 9 (4):125-128.
    Human cholinesterase has recently been sequenced and cloned. It is a glycoprotein of 4 identical subunits, each subunit containing 9 carbohydrate chains and 3.5 disulfide bonds. Protein folding is likely to be very similar in human cholinesterase and Torpedo acetylcholinesterase. The cholinesterases have no significant sequence homology with the serine proteases and seem to belong to a separate serine esterase family.
